The 2010 Macau Grand Prix was the 57th Macau Grand Prix . It took place on November 21, 2010 at the Guia Circuit in Macau .

Reports

background

At the Macau Grand Prix 2010, 30 drivers from the British Formula 3 Championship , the German Formula 3 Cup , the European F3 Open , the Formula 3 Euro Series , the Formula Renault 3.5 , the GP3 Series and the Japanese Formula competed -3 championship . Last year's winner Edoardo Mortara , who won the Formula 3 Euro Series this season, as well as Jean-Éric Vergne , the British Formula 3 champion, and Yūji Kunimoto , the Japanese Formula 3 champion, started among others this race.

13 pilots started with Volkswagen , 12 pilots with Mercedes-Benz , 3 pilots with Toyota - and 1 each with Honda and Nissan engines.

Qualifying

In the first qualifying on Thursday, Mortara set the fastest lap ahead of Valtteri Bottas and his team-mate Marco Wittmann . After qualifying, various pilots were penalized five positions for ignoring yellow flags. The second qualifying session was postponed from Friday to Saturday due to accidents in other racing series that were also represented in Macau. Mortara also achieved the fastest lap here, ahead of Bottas. Laurens Vanthoor went third . The pole position of the qualifying race thus went to Mortara. Bottas and Vanthoor followed in second and third place.

Qualifying race

In the qualifying race, in which the starting grid for the race was determined, Mortara won. The Signature driver achieved a start-to-finish victory in front of his teammates Vanthoor and Daniel Abt . While Mortara's top position was only in jeopardy at the start, Vanthoor first had to overtake Abt. Vanthoor achieved this in the third round. Abt finally managed to keep Bottas behind him and finished in third place. Only drivers from the Formula 3 Euro Series were in the first five positions. Renger van der Zande (GP3 series) was the best driver from another championship.

The winner Mortara then classified the victory of the qualifying race as follows: “My start wasn't that good, but I was able to repeat the lead on the first lap. When my lead was big enough, I reduced some speed. This victory is nice, but it is really important tomorrow, because only then is the main race of the weekend on the program. "

run

Mortara initially retained the lead in Macau. After the restart after a safety car phase, Abt took over the lead of the race. However, Abt retired while in the lead after an accident. The 17-year-old racing driver suddenly had understeer in a left turn, hit the right guardrail and took a left. Then Vanthoor was in a lead until he was overtaken by Mortara after the restart after another safety car phase. Mortara managed to further increase his lead in the following laps and he finally won the race. Vanthoor was second ahead of Bottas. Mortara is the first driver to win the Formula 3 race in Macau for the second time.

Mortara was delighted with the win as follows: “To be the first driver to win the Macau Grand Prix twice in a row feels great and is a great honor. But it was not an easy game for me and there was strong competition this year as well. Laurens Vanthoor and Daniel Abt asked everything from me. When I was finally in front, I gave 120 percent to set myself apart from the pursuers and take home the win. "
